Your Role
As part of the Customer Services Department, you will be the main point of contact for hauliers and drivers at the Port of Liverpool, managing the effective flow of trucks that enter the terminal, to be served exchanging containers and to leave safely and promptly.
In this role you will work from our state-of-the-art Gate system, handling different traffic volumes and co‑ordinating traffic management from the road into the port. You will ensure the efficient reporting of faults, supporting engineers and our IT team to resolve these.
You will follow a structured training programme providing all of the development you require to be effective in this role and for your ongoing career progression. You will work a weekly rotating shift pattern across early, late, night and mid‑shifts, including weekend working as required.
What you’ll bring
You will have customer service experience, ideally in a Transport, Warehousing, Gate or Depot environment. You will have experience of using Microsoft Office packages and managing and reporting data. High levels of attention to detail are also essential as well as strong written and verbal communication skills.
